3Trip time meter “TRIP TIME”
This function records the elapsed time
of your current trip, or since it was last
reset. Trip time is displayed in “_h
_min” (hours and minutes).
TIP
The trip time meter will automati-
cally reset 4 hours after the key
was last turned to “OFF”.
To manually reset the trip time me-
ter, push the “RESET” button for
two seconds. However, the
odometer and tripmeter display
must be set to “ODO”, otherwise
the tripmeter will be reset instead.
Oil change trip meter “DIST SERV”
This function shows the distance trav-
eled since your last oil service. It will re-
set when the oil change indicator is
reset.Oil change indicator “OIL”
This indicator flashes (“OIL SERV”
message will also appear) to indicate
that the engine oil should be changed.
It will come on at the initial 1000 km
(600 mi) service interval, 2000 km
(1200 mi) after that, and every 3000 km
(1800 mi) thereafter. After changing the
engine oil, be sure to reset the oil
change indicator.
To reset the oil change indicator, make
sure the odometer and tripmeter dis-
play is set to “ODO”, then push the
“RESET” button for two seconds until
“OIL SERV” message flashes, and then
push and hold the “RESET” button for
15 seconds.

Low battery indicator “ ”
This indicator flashes (“LOW BATT”
message will also appear) when the
battery voltage is under 10 volts.
TIP
If the low battery indicator comes on,
check and recharge the battery as nec-
essary. (See page 6-31.)
Warning and service messages
This function works in conjunction with
fuel meter, coolant temperature meter,
oil change indicator, and low battery
indicator by displaying a correspond-
ing warning or service message. When
two or more messages occur, push the“INFO” button to switch between and
check all messages in the following or-
der:
HIGH TEMP →LOW FUEL →LOW
BATT →OIL SERV

Hydraulic brake service
• Regularly check and, if necessary, correct the brake fluid level.
• Every two years change the brake fluid.
• Replace the brake hoses every four years and if cracked or damaged.
